Radiation News Roundup December 26, 2014

Journalist Ryuichi Kino has documents a large number of injuries to workers in 2014 that TEPCO has not made public. fukukeads.org

A construction company hired a high school student for work to decontaminate houses tainted with radiation from the Fukushima nuclear disaster, the Mainichi Shimbun has learned. mainichi.jp

Three South Korean workers died today after apparently inhaling toxic gas at a construction site for a nuclear plant being built by South Korea’s monopoly nuclear power company, which has come under recent threats by hackers, a company official said.  economictimes.indiatimes.com

South Korea’s nuclear operator and the energy ministry will keep emergency teams on stand-by to the end of this year in case of any cyber attacks on nuclear plants as threatened by a hacker. standardmedia.co.ke
